Cluj-Napoca International Airport

The Cluj-Napoca International Airport is located on road E576, six miles from the center of Cluj-Napoca. Eight airlines service the airport, including Aegean Airlines, Sky Airlines, Air Bucharest and Wizz Air. Parking and Transportation

If you want to leave your car at the airport while you travel, there is a long-term parking lot located across from the passenger terminal. Parking costs depend on the number of days you would like park your car there, ranging from 95 Romanian Leu ($25.77) for two days to 310 Romanian Leu ($86.81) for 15 days. Alternatively, you can also leave your car at home and hop on public transportation to the airport. Bus 8 runs from the city to the airport every 10 minutes on weekdays and every 30 minutes on the weekend. Bus tickets cost 1.75 Romanian Leu ($0.47). Taxicabs are also available, running on meters that charge approximately 1.70 Romanian Leu ($0.46) per half mile. Dining at the Airport

If you want to grab a bite to eat before your flight, the airport has two dining options to choose from. Restaurant Maria offers full meals and drinks while the Café-Bar has a wide range of snacks, pastries, ice cream, drinks and alcoholic beverages. Istanbul Area Airports

The main airport for the city, Istanbul Atatürk International Airport, is located on the European side of the city, about 24 kilometers from the downtown area. Sabiha Gokcen International Airport is on the Asian side of Istanbul, about 35 kilometers southeast of the city center. Istanbul Atatürk International Airport handles flights from over 70 airlines, including British Airways, United Airlines, Turkish Airlines, and Air France. Sabiha Gokcen International Airport serves over 30 airlines, including Sky Airlines, EasyJet, Turkish Airlines, and SunExpress.

Getting to the Airport

From Istanbul Atatürk International Airport, arriving visitors can opt to take the metro train or sea bus into Istanbul. The Sabiha Gokcen airport shuttle makes regular trips from Sabiha Gokcen International Airport to various points within the city, and it costs 10 euro per person. Visitors can also get into the city from Sabiha Gokcen International Airport via sea bus or public bus. Both airports are also accessible via taxi.

Weather Conditions in Istanbul

In the summer, high temperatures average around 82 degrees Fahrenheit in June and July and drop to lows of around 65 degrees Fahrenheit at night. Rain is uncommon in the summer, although the humidity remains high during the summer months. Winters are often cold and snowy. In January, temperatures average between 37 to 47 degrees Fahrenheit. Spring and fall tend to be mild, and the bargain prices offered during these seasons make them ideal for a visit.

Vacationing in Istanbul

Take in a bit of history with a visit to Topkapi Palace, the Grand Bazaar, or one of the many Ottoman mosques scattered throughout the city. Archaeology museums are another popular attraction, or you can get tickets for a cruise on the Bosphorus to get a view of the city from the water.
